Original 89661-0N071 TD275300-2992 12V ECU ECM Engine Control Unit Motor Computer Module PCM 896610N071 For Toyota

Original 89661-0N071 TD275300-2992 12V ECU ECM Engine Control Unit Motor Computer Module PCM 896610N071 For Toyota
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005704886422
$294.84
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ed